What types of damages can I receive compensation for in a motorcycle accident case?
Motorcycle accident victims in Melbourne Village can pursue several categories of damages. Economic damages include quantifiable losses such as medical expenses (emergency care, hospitalization, surgeries, medications, rehabilitation, and future treatment costs), lost wages during recovery, diminished future earning capacity, property damage, and out-of-pocket expenses. These cases often involve more extensive injuries than those seen by car accident lawyers in Melbourne Village due to the exposed nature of motorcycle riding.
Non-economic damages address the less tangible but equally important impacts of your accident, including physical pain and suffering, emotional distress, loss of enjoyment of life, permanent disfigurement or disability, and loss of consortium (impact on marital relationship). In particularly egregious cases involving intentional misconduct or gross negligence, punitive damages may also be available. Our attorneys calculate the full value of your claim based on detailed analysis of both current and future impacts.
What should I do after a motorcycle accident?
Immediately following a motorcycle accident in Melbourne Village, prioritize your safety and health by seeking medical attention, even if injuries seem minor—some serious conditions may have delayed symptoms. If you're able, call 911 to report the accident and ensure police document the scene. Collect evidence by taking photographs of vehicle positions, road conditions (especially noting Melbourne Village's unique characteristics like narrow roads or limited visibility areas), skid marks, and your injuries.
Exchange information with other involved parties but avoid discussing fault or making statements that could be interpreted as accepting blame. Gather contact information from witnesses, as their statements can be crucial. Notify your insurance company of the accident but provide only basic facts. Most importantly, contact our motorcycle accident attorneys before giving recorded statements to any insurance companies or accepting settlement offers, as early offers rarely reflect the true value of your claim.
How is liability determined in a motorcycle accident?
Liability in motorcycle accidents is determined by establishing which party or parties acted negligently by breaching their duty of care. Our attorneys gather evidence to prove the other driver violated traffic laws, was distracted, impaired, or otherwise negligent. We combat the unfortunate bias against motorcyclists by thoroughly documenting road conditions, visibility factors, and the specific circumstances of your accident, especially in complex scenarios where hit and run accident attorneys must investigate with limited initial information.
Florida follows a comparative negligence system, meaning your compensation may be reduced by your percentage of fault in causing the accident. For example, if you're found 20% responsible, you would receive 80% of the awarded damages. Our firm works diligently to minimize any assignment of fault to you by presenting compelling evidence and expert testimony that clearly establishes the other party's responsibility for your injuries.
How does no cost representation for motorcycle accident cases work?
Our Melbourne Village motorcycle accident lawyers operate on a contingency fee basis, meaning you pay absolutely nothing upfront for our services. Initial consultations are completely free, allowing us to evaluate your case and provide guidance without any financial obligation on your part. We cover all costs associated with investigating your accident, gathering evidence, consulting with experts, and preparing your case.
You only pay attorney fees if we successfully recover compensation for you through settlement or court verdict. At that point, our fee is a predetermined percentage of your recovery—an arrangement that aligns our interests with yours and demonstrates our confidence in our ability to win your case. This structure ensures that quality legal representation is accessible to all motorcycle accident victims regardless of their financial situation, particularly during a time when medical bills and lost wages may be causing significant hardship.
